Toy loon becomes unofficial mascot for Canadian women's Olympic hockey team
A toy loon from a fan has become a mascot, or possibly a good luck charm, for Canada's women's hockey team at Milano Cortina 2026.

MILAN, Feb 15 : Switzerland beat Czech Republic 4-3 in the first overtime win of the men's Olympic ice hockey tournament on Sunday, finishing second in Group A behind powerhouse Canada, as the final day of the preliminary stage kicked off at Santagiulia arena.
ANTERSELVA, ITALY, Feb 15 : Sixteen years after coming second to Evgeny Ustyugov in the biathlon 15km mass start at the Vancouver Games, Frenchman Martin Fourcade was finally awarded the gold medal following the disqualification of the Russian for anti-doping violations.
CORTINA D'AMPEZZO, Italy, Feb 15 : Germany's World Cup winner Laura Nolte carried her hot season's form into the Olympics on Sunday when she built a healthy lead at the halfway point of the women's Monobob, with two vastly experienced Americans sitting just behind her.
BORMIO, Italy, Feb 15 : Alpine skiers face an unusual challenge at the men's Winter Olympics slalom in Bormio on Monday: a flatter-than-usual and deceptively tricky slalom course.
CORTINA D'AMPEZZO, Italy, Feb 15 : Bruce Mouat's British men's team picked up a 9-4 round-robin win over Germany at the Winter Games on Sunday, while Olympic champions Sweden suffered their fourth loss of the campaign to leave their title defence on the brink.
